The timeless “Magnum P.I.” duo, Tom Selleck, 78, and Larry Manetti, 75, reunite 35 years after they last shared the screen. Here’s what we know about Manetti’s surprise cameo and the latest season of NBC’s Blue Bloods.
The Big Cameo
Larry Manetti was spotted alongside the Blue Bloods cast for his guest appearance in the hit TV show and shared a reunion moment with his Magnum P.I. co-star and “Blue Bloods” actor, Tom Selleck.
Instagram Announcements
The news came recently when Donnie Wahlberg shared a picture of the cast of Blue Bloods together with the legendary duo, captioned, “#MagnumMonday! It’s a mini Magnum PI reunion on the set of #BlueBloods this week, with guest star Larry Manetti & Tom Selleck — together again.

A Commanding Appearance
TVLine learned that in the latest season of Blue Bloods, Manetti would be playing a retired cop, Sam Velucci, who holds at gunpoint the culprit who sold fentanyl-laced pills to his grandson.

A Peep Into ‘Magnum P.I.’

The series revolved around Thomas Sullivan Magnum, played by Tom Selleck, a private investigator who handpicks his own cases for investigation. Manetti, on the other hand, played the role of Orville ‘Rick” Wright, who was a bar owner in the show.
A Look Back At John Hillerman

John Hillerman, who played Jonathan Higgins in the show, passed away in 2017 at the age of 84.
A Look Back At Roger Mosley

The 4th member of the Magnum 4, Theodore ‘T.C’ Calvin, played by Roger Mosley, passed away in 2022 at the age of 83.
